Definitely still feeling the effects of Monday’s session. My legs didn’t have much in them today but I was working more on technique more so than trying to go for any type of plyo benefit. I tried to focus mostly on the Step-jump transition as well as the landing. I’m having trouble undoing bad habits but it came along a bit. I did seven steps into step-jump but I found that I wasn’t able to control that speed so I may move down to five next week. I started to think about it afterwards, if I’m doing seven step in the step phase that’s probably close to full approach speed from a hop-step. I may reduce the bounding next week and do more technical rehearsal drills like Hop repeats and continue to work on step jump.
